Tesla to recall 125,227 vehicles over faulty seat belt warning system

It appears that Tesla has issued a recall of about 125,227 vehicles due to problems with the seat belt warning system. Recall notices are usually issued when a manufacturer identifies a defect or problem with one of their products that could possibly harm the safety of the consumer. In this case, the recall of these Tesla vehicles suggests that there is a problem with the seat belt warning system, which may be malfunctioning or not operating correctly. Affected customers will likely be contacted by the company to arrange for repairs or replacement of the necessary parts. It is always important to respond to such recalls promptly to ensure your safety while operating the vehicle.
